Pros
-Friendly environment- Truly a place where your coworkers become family and friends. -A lot of room for learning new skills- I've learned a lot of skills that I didn't realize would be useful in both personal life and professional life as well as being able to be used in different industries. -Flexibility with personal life -Really nice office space -Employees are respected as individuals and the sense of "Teamwork" in the office is a big reason for staying so long -Really great opportunity for a first dive into the logistics industry and for people looking to dip their toe into the "professional" world -Casual but appropriate dress code
Cons
-Cost of living has skyrocketed and that does not reflect in the pay of new or already existing employees -Non-competitive starting pay -Uncertain and unclear career paths -No yearly pay bumps or compensation -Difficulty moving up in certain roles -Tenure is respected but not always a factor when it comes to advancing in your position
